The ballot has been announced, and voting for the 2014 Cóyotl Awards is now open! Votes will be accepted through Saturday, August 15, and all guild members (writers and associates) are eligible to vote.
Congratulations to the 2014 nominees:
Best Novel
The Bees by Laline Paull
Bête by Adam Roberts
Off the Beaten Path by Rukis
Best Novella
Going Concerns by Watts Martin
Huntress by Renee Carter Hall
The Mysterious Affair of Giles by Kyell Gold
Best Short Story
"Cold Scent" by Alice Dryden
"Jackalope Wives" by Ursula Vernon
"Pavlov’s House" by Malcolm Cross
Best Anthology
Abandoned Places edited by Tarl “Voice” Hoch
Tales from the Guild: Music to Your Ears edited by AnthroAquatic
